
University of Hawaiʻi at 惭ā苍辞补 esports won its first collegiate tournament in program history capturing the and the $2,500 top prize. The team went undefeated in bracket play, taking down nine schools including the University of Arizona, Texas A&M University and Canada’s Carleton University in the finals. The best of three, single elimination tournament took place virtually from September 19–October 10.
Valorant is a multiplayer first-person shooting game, and players are assigned to either the attacking or defending teams. It is part of the skyrocketing esports industry, with revenue projected to hit . 东精影业 惭ā苍辞补 esports, which began in 2019, is making a national statement in Valorant. The team ended spring 2021 as one of the top three collegiate teams in the nation and started the fall semester on a high note taking the top spot in one of the season’s first tournaments.

Up next

The Valorant team is in the midst of its next tournament, the Conference One 2021 Fall Valorant tournament. It is currently in group stages, with the top two teams from each group making the playoffs.
Miyamoto attributes the team’s recent success to having a positive attitude.
“We are very mentally strong during matches and even if we start losing nobody gets mad or has a negative attitude. Since everyone has a positive mindset, we are able to perform our best throughout each series,” Miyamoto said.
